I have been learning RoR from Simply Rails 2. I have successfully made a
project which opens with http://localhost:3000/stories. I am trying to
run another project(browserCMS) and the install instructions say it
should open with
http://localhost:3000/cms but I get the following errors
 NameError in CmsController#index
uninitialized constant CmsController
RAILS_ROOT: /home/neil/Desktop/RoR/ruby-1.8.6/shovell

shovell is the root directory of the stories project. Can I cure this by
changing RAILS_ROOT? If so how?
